Professional Background
Tamara Luengo is a passionate and dedicated professional in the field of water resource management, with extensive experience in project management and inter-institutional relations within the water sector. Tamara has built a robust career centered around sustainable water management practices, emphasizing skills in the governance and equitable use of water resources. Currently, she serves as a Project Manager for Smart Cities & Consulting at SUEZ, where she leads innovative projects aimed at creating sustainable urban environments that are resilient to water scarcity and climate change.
Her previous role as Líder de desenvolvimento de projetos at SUEZ allowed her to hone her project development skills while working on initiatives that support sustainable urban development and enhance water efficiency. Earlier in her career, she worked as a civil engineer on various projects at Jacobs, where she contributed her technical expertise to ensure the success of critical infrastructure projects. Tamara also served as an Assistant Technical Officer at the Secretaria de Infraestructura, Movilidad y Transporte del Estado de Puebla, where she collaborated with government bodies to enhance regional infrastructure.
In addition to her professional work, Tamara has made significant contributions to academia. As a former professor at Universidad de América Latina, she taught courses on Wastewater Treatment and Potable Water Supply in the Civil Engineering program. Through her teaching, she sought to inspire future engineers to prioritize sustainable and equitable management practices in the use of water resources.
Education and Achievements
Tamara Luengo holds a Bachelor's degree in Civil Engineering from the prestigious Tecnológico de Monterrey, a top-ranking educational institution in Mexico known for its focus on innovation and technology. Throughout her academic journey, Tamara consistently demonstrated her commitment to excellence and her passion for her chosen field. Her pursuit of knowledge led her to further her studies and obtain a Master's degree in Integrated Water Resources Management from the Instituto Mexicano de Tecnología del Agua. This advanced degree provided her with a comprehensive understanding of the challenges and solutions in managing water resources effectively and sustainably.
